## Tuning

Per last week's discussion, Relaywick now enables permessage-deflate on all socket tiers by default. Compression cuts bandwidth roughly 60% on our telemetry frames, but the per-connection sliding window costs memory, and CPU rises noticeably above 8k concurrent clients on the Fenholt cluster. We settled on a middle ground: compress only frames over a size threshold, cap the window bits, and disable context takeover on the mobile tier. The constants below reflect the values we validated in staging.

tuning constants:
QUOTAS = {
    "druwyn": 5,
    "holix": 5,
    "zorath": 5,
    "holwyn": 10,
}

Ticket: Config drift in SQL lint rules

We've noticed that plugin-provided rulesets for Quillcheck have drifted from the canonical profile shipped in core. Plugins targeting the v4 hook API must align their rule severities with the baseline before the next certification pass, or validation will fail. To help authors reconcile differences, the current canonical configuration is listed below:

deployment values, fahap-hahaf:
[casdor]
port = 9200
region = south-2
host = casdor.qirvanworks.corp
timeout_ms = 3000
retries = 4

## SDK Parity Check

Before approving any change to the Lumenquill Swift SDK, confirm the equivalent behavior exists in the Kotlin SDK or that a parity ticket has been filed. Pay particular attention to retry semantics, pagination defaults, and error enum names — these have drifted twice before and caused subtle client bugs. Run the cross-SDK contract suite on both branches and attach the diff summary to the review. The full parity matrix, including known intentional gaps, is maintained here.

dashboard of tagag-kadug = https://confluence.zemvarsys.internal/projects/projects/display/pages

### Step 3 — Register the Transcode Workers

Each new worker joining the Foxglove transcoding farm must be registered before it can pull jobs. Run the enrollment script from the worker itself, not from your workstation, so hardware fingerprints are captured correctly. The controller will refuse enrollment unless the request is signed. When prompted during enrollment, supply the farm's current deploy signing key, shown below.

release key, yagap-kagag: bky6_1ks93y